C语言PAT练习题及学习代码压缩包
需积分: 1 128 浏览量
更新于2024-12-28
收藏 151KB ZIP 举报
资源摘要信息:"PAT部分题目和C语言学习代码.zip文件包含了多个与PAT(Programming Ability Test,程序设计能力测试)相关的题目和相应的C语言解决方案。PAT是一种针对计算机编程能力的测试,旨在评估和提高编程人员在算法和数据结构方面的实践能力。C语言作为其中一种被广泛使用的编程语言,因其接近硬件的特性以及强大的表达能力,成为了许多技术评估和教学的首选语言。
在压缩包内可能包含的文件名称,例如 'code_21206',暗示这是一个特定的题目的代码实现。通常,PAT考试分为多个难度等级,包括入门级、基础级、提高级和挑战级。每种难度级别的题目对算法和编程技巧的要求都不尽相同。题目可能包括但不限于数组操作、字符串处理、数学计算、逻辑推理、图论算法、动态规划、排序查找等。
学习C语言对于准备PAT考试非常重要,因为C语言的特性允许程序员更好地理解内存管理、指针操作和系统调用等底层细节。掌握C语言有助于在解决复杂问题时提供更精细的控制。
针对压缩包中的文件,可以预期内容涉及到以下知识点和技能:
1. 基本语法:C语言的基本数据类型、运算符、控制流程(如if-else、for、while循环)、函数定义和使用。
2. 数据结构:结构体(struct)的使用、数组操作、链表、栈、队列、树、图等复杂数据结构的实现和应用。
3. 算法思想:递归、分治、动态规划、贪心算法、回溯算法、搜索算法等基本算法思想和在实际问题中的应用。
4. 系统编程:文件操作、内存管理(动态分配)、进程和线程的基本概念及其在C语言中的实现。
5. 调试技巧:学会使用调试工具,如gdb,理解和分析程序运行时的行为。
6. 代码优化:提高代码效率,包括算法优化、减少时间复杂度和空间复杂度。
7. PAT考试策略:掌握考试题型、答题技巧以及如何在规定时间内完成题目。
由于本压缩包文件内容未直接提供,以上所述知识点和技能为可能包含的内容。用户在解压后应能通过阅读和理解C语言代码来学习对应的算法和编程技巧。同时,对于想要提高编程能力的人来说,PAT考试题目是一个很好的练习资源,而C语言的学习代码则是掌握计算机编程基础的基石。"
点击了解资源详情
点击了解资源详情
221 浏览量
2024-02-27 上传
2023-04-09 上传
2024-01-14 上传
2023-04-22 上传
105 浏览量
2025-01-01 上传
土豆片片
- 粉丝: 1856
- 资源: 5869
最新资源
- Ps基本功能PPT,附带简单的技巧讲解
- 电脑硬件故障引起系统问题
- 关于LCD的一些知识
- 自动测试 IBM Rational 技术白皮书
- cmake 学习教程
- protues学习教程
- XP下的JDK安装.DOC
- Fedora-10-Installation-Configration-FAQ-Update-1
- Fedora-10-Installaion_Configuration-FAQ
- linux驱动程序设计入门简洁教程
- C与C++中的异常处理
- SCJP 1.6 TestInside真题(中文,台湾人译的)
- 基于单片机控制的自动往返小汽车新设计.pdf
- 中兴公司CDMA原理
- EJB 3 In Action - Manning
- 水晶报表用户指南 9.0